Output 62c59b89b28f1404aa4c85a60a57475808ebc807d124a83686027811ac441c69:0

value
10010000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b20cea8057b20cdce453daf5f9c10991e55ae64 OP_EQUAL
address
32hrf9AqPK3FnZwEx3QKprty3yLCcQGcb3
transaction
62c59b89b28f1404aa4c85a60a57475808ebc807d124a83686027811ac441c69
spent
true